Took summer route up and down Gastineau to check out ice crust before any new snow falls. I don't have a lot of experience with ice/rain crusts accept that nasty one two years ago. The current ice crust on the ridges of Gastineau seems similar to two years ago. Very smooth, slick, and potentially bad? Something to think about after then next storm comes.
